Abstract


The #EndSARS movement in Nigeria brought to the fore decades of unresolved issues relating to police brutality, human rights abuses, and the absence of effective legal remedies. This article explores the historical and legal context of police misconduct in Nigeria, critically examines the role and actions of the Special Anti-Robbery Squad (SARS), and evaluates the legal remedies available to victims of police brutality. Through an in-depth analysis of the #EndSARS protests of 2020, the paper highlights the gaps in Nigeria’s legal and institutional framework and offers recommendations for comprehensive police reform and human rights protection.
